WSCl₄ (tungsten tetrachloride) is a transition metal halide compound that exists primarily as a research and industrial chemical intermediate rather than a structural or functional engineering material in its pure form. It is encountered in materials processing workflows—particularly in chemical vapor deposition (CVD), tungsten metallurgy, and specialty synthesis—where it serves as a tungsten source or precursor. Engineers and materials scientists select tungsten halides for applications requiring controlled tungsten incorporation, high-purity deposition, or as a reactant in synthesis routes where chloride chemistry offers better process control or economic advantage over alternative tungsten compounds.
